Tumwater Falls is not just any spot on the map; it's where the Deschutes River bursts into a series of cascades. Whether you're here for a brisk afternoon walk away from the office on a summer afternoon or take in the surroundings all day, the falls offer a versatile environment for leisure activities.

Brewery Park at Tumwater Falls, one of the many local legacies of the former Olympia Brewery and the founding Schmidt family, was created in 1962 as a gift to the citizens of Thurston County. This generous gesture was aimed at preserving open space, sustaining the natural habitat, and maintaining the history of the Deschutes River Canyon. The park is run privately, showcasing the commitment to safeguarding nature while offering the public a picturesque and historical site to enjoy, reflecting the deep-rooted values of community and conservation held by the Schmidt family.

Begin your exploration on the half-mile loop trail weaving through the falls. The loop circles the river and the falls and crosses over in two locations where you can view the upper and lower falls. Take a detour down to the lower platform and feel the mist of the falls on your face. You can also get a glimpse of the old brewery building on the lower bridge. As you meander back on the trail, other buildings of the Olympia Brewing Company come into view. Standing as images of another era.

A Day at Historic Park

Further down the trail lies a historic park, a city of Tumwater Park, which is the perfect setting for family outings. Spacious grounds invite you to lay down a blanket and picnic under the shade of trees or the picnic shelter. The expansive playground offers kids of all ages the opportunity to get out there and run around.

For hobbyist photographers and professionals alike, Tumwater Falls and Historic Park offer a canvas to capture the falls and a closer picture of the old brewery. From Historic Park, you get a front-and-center look at the old building. The park also connects to the Capitol Lake trail, offering a seamless connection for those seeking a longer walk or run. By following the trail under Interstate 5, visitors will discover an additional nature trail with two docks, providing a vantage point to look over the river and lake. If you keep going, you will hit Deschutes Parkway and head down to Marathon Park. Here, you can begin circling the lake, and taking in the views of downtown, the bay, and the Capitol.
